Sun Scorched Zombie CR: 1/2

Medium undead, any
Armor Class: 8
Hit Points: 22 (3d8 + 9)
Speed: 20 ft

STR

13 +1

DEX

6 -2

CON

16 +3

INT

3 -4

WIS

6 -2

CHA

5 -3

Damage Resistances: Fire
Senses: Darkvision 60 ft., Passive Perception 8
Languages: Any Language it knew in life, but cannot speak it
Challenge Rating: 1/2
by Midjourney

At will: Fiery Gaze (Su): A sunbaked zombie's eye sockets flicker with a small flame that gives light equivalent to that of a candle. As a standard action, a sunbaked zombie can direct its gaze against a single creature within 15 feet of it. A creature targeted must succeed at a Fortitude save or take ld6 points of fire damage.


Undead Fortitude. If damage reduces the zombie to 0 hit points, it must make a Constitution saving throw with a DC of 5 + the damage taken, unless the damage is radiant or from a critical hit. On a success, the zombie drops to 1 hit point instead.

Actions

Slam. Melee Weapon Attack: +3 to hit, reach 5 ft., one target. Hit: 4 (1d6 + 1) bludgeoning damage.

One of the terrible fates in the Deshret is not making it through its trials. a nameless death buried in the sand is not all bad. Even being picked on by scavengers is only part of the circle of life. A WORSE fate is your body being left to bake under the merciless sun, where the whispers of rituals of incantations and curses still hold power on the wind. it is by this fate you become sun scorched as negative Ka finds refuge. Other than the dry, leathery skin clinging to the creature’s bones, the most striking physical difference between a sunbaked zombie and a normal zombie is the sunbaked zombie’s flame-filled eye sockets. Though it lacks functioning eyes—those having long since shriveled to dust—the sunbaked zombie can see as well as any other zombie, and the flames in its dried sockets can set enemies afir. The sunscorched are considered mindless, though more specifically they have no original motivation. legends speak of magical words whispered on the desert winds giving them direction to some long forgotten purpose. So far the Sun-Scorched slowly shamble towards the rising sun.   Modified from Sunbaked Zombie, Pathfinder Empty Graves p.88

Suggested Environments

Sun-Scorched zombies most often rise near pyramids and other burial sites in hot deserts, where latent necromantic energy lingers from countless arcane rituals and restless spirits.
